James Rodríguez Reveals Why He Left São Paulo and Criticizes Dorival Júnior

James Rodríguez’s time at São Paulo did not go as expected, and now the Colombian midfielder has finally revealed the reasons behind his underwhelming performance at the club. In a recent interview, James stated that his lack of opportunities under Dorival Júnior was the main factor for his failure at the Tricolor Paulista.

James Rodríguez at São Paulo: What Went Wrong?

Signed as a marquee player in 2023, James arrived at São Paulo with high expectations but had limited chances on the field. During his interview, the player made direct criticisms of coach Dorival Júnior, claiming that his lack of playing time hindered his performance and adaptation to Brazilian football.

James Rodríguez’s Statement:

“I didn’t play, and when a player doesn’t play, he can’t show what he can do. That’s why my time at São Paulo didn’t work out.”

The Colombian played only 14 matches for the club, scoring 1 goal and providing 3 assists, numbers considered low for a player of his caliber and experience.

The Relationship Between James Rodríguez and Dorival Júnior

James also mentioned that Dorival Júnior’s lack of confidence in his abilities was crucial to his departure. The Colombian midfielder joined the club during a rebuilding phase and saw players like Lucas Moura and Luciano being consistently selected while he remained on the bench.

Despite his successful career, including stints at Real Madrid, Bayern Munich, and Everton, James couldn’t fit into the coach’s system and ended up leaving the club at the beginning of 2024.

Possible Internal Conflicts

Sources close to São Paulo claim that besides technical issues, James struggled to adapt to the physical demands of Brazilian football. Lack of chemistry with teammates and possible internal problems may also have contributed to his short stint with the club.

James Rodríguez’s Future in Football

After leaving São Paulo, James Rodríguez is now evaluating offers to determine his next club. The player has been linked to teams in Qatar, Saudi Arabia, and MLS, but has yet to confirm his next move for the 2025 season.

At 33 years old, the Colombian is looking for a project that will give him more playing time and a chance to finish his career at a high level.

Conclusion: What Can We Learn from James’s Time at São Paulo?

James Rodríguez’s time at São Paulo will be remembered as a missed opportunity for both sides. The club signed a world-class player but couldn’t integrate him into the team. Meanwhile, James, despite his talent, failed to adapt to Brazilian football and left the club without making a significant impact.
